About this work

This painting shows a row of old buildings by a canal. The colors are earthy—yellows, reds, and greens—with green shutters on the windows. A small boat floats in the water, and the buildings lean slightly, as if they’re leaning over the canal. The brushstrokes are thick, especially on the walls, giving the scene a textured look. The artist used bold colors and loose brushwork to make the buildings feel alive. The way the light hits the buildings suggests a warm, sunny day, but the painting doesn’t feel polished—it’s more like a quick sketch of a real place.
